Nigeria: Bakare Calls for Transitional Govt

5 January 2015

Former vice-presidential candidate to General Muhammadu Buhari on the defunct Congress for Progressive Change (CPC) platform and founder, Latter Rain Assembly, Pastor Tunde Bakare, during a sermon in his church, reiterated his earlier warning that considering the prevailing "political temperature," Nigerians should jettison the idea of conducting the February elections.

As an alternative, he opines that President Goodluck Jonathan should continue in office for another two years on the basis of interim government arrangement.
